“In At the moment’s period of volatility, there is no such thing as a different manner however to re-invent. The one sustainable benefit you may have over others is agility, that’s it. As a result of nothing else is sustainable, all the things else you create, any individual else will replicate.” — Jeff Bezos, Founder, Amazon.
The world of expertise is evolving at a quick tempo, with newly rising superior functions nearly daily. With the numerous progress of expertise, we will additionally witness the transition of corporations from legacy techniques to trendy techniques. That’s what offers your small business true agility.
Utility modernization assists corporations in eliminating unnecessary working prices, reducing capital expenditures, and liberating up staff to pursue new initiatives and revenue-generating plans. On this article, we are going to take a look at what modernizing your system software seems to be like and the way it can profit your organization’s progress and success.
What Is Utility Modernization?
In easy phrases, it’s the apply of updating outdated software program techniques, often known as legacy techniques, to be able to retain the reminiscence knowledge however nonetheless profit from the brand new framework. It’s like renovating a home. Reasonably than discarding the older system, we may give it transform and improve its effectivity.
The worldwide software modernization providers market was valued at USD 11838.15 million in 2021 and is predicted to develop at a CAGR of 14.31% over the forecast interval, reaching USD 26405.06 million by 2027. For a lot of companies, this entails re-programming current legacy workloads onto present cloud-based platforms or splitting monolithic software program into smaller elements, resembling microservices, after which programming these microservices.
Why Has It Turn out to be Important?
The principle and most evident cause for software modernization is to reinforce effectivity, which is able to in flip give the corporate a greater stand on this immensely aggressive trade. Modernizing apps could assist companies make the most of new expertise and streamline processes amongst different issues.
Keep in mind that there’s an unseen price in attempting to make do with legacy software program. Outdated software program can cut back productiveness, stifle growth, and degrade the shopper expertise. Alternatively, a robust software modernization plan may also decrease the assets wanted to run an software, improve the frequency and dependability of deployments, and enhance uptime and resilience.
Prime Advantages
Listed under are the highest advantages you may expertise by modernizing your system software program:
1. Improved effectivity: Modernizing functions permits organizations to simplify processes, reduce layoffs, and automate repetitive procedures, leading to increased productiveness and useful resource utilization. App modernization additionally helps to keep up quite a lot of current procedures, making certain firm continuity. In line with IBM, upgrading legacy techniques can enhance developer productiveness by as much as 40%.
2. Value advantages: You’ll minimize bills, enhance dependability, and enhance shopper confidence, and likewise place your group to grab new prospects quicker. In line with Intel, current analysis discovered that when organizations decrease their technical debt load by updating their legacy app portfolio, they get speedy financial savings of 32% of their IT expenditure.
3. Scalability: Modernized functions are sometimes constructed to be extra scalable, making it less complicated to deal with rising workloads and reply to adjustments in consumer demand. That is vital for companies as they develop and have to assist a bigger consumer base or extra refined processes.
4. Flexibility: The pliability of a enterprise goes hand-in-hand with its capability to scale from smaller consumer bases to bigger consumer bases. It will also be seen from the angle that with superior expertise as your spine, your organization is extra versatile to variations, upgrades, and adjustments basically. Agility is a product of flexibility and one of the best instance for that is how Pinterest grew its consumer base from 50,000 to 17 million in solely 9 months by transferring its processing and storage to Amazon Internet Companies.
5. Consumer expertise: For any group, buyer expertise is the topmost precedence. Giving your customers what they need and conserving them glad is the principle objective. Modernized packages steadily have extra user-friendly interfaces, enhanced navigation, and responsive design. This improves the consumer expertise and helps to retain customers, maybe resulting in increased buyer satisfaction and loyalty
6. Integration capabilities: Modernized functions present for simpler integration with different techniques and third-party providers. That is vital for companies attempting to ascertain a unified digital surroundings through which knowledge and processes move seamlessly between apps and platforms. As functions migrate to the cloud, the power to hyperlink them to databases and different assets turns into vital in producing price financial savings and enhanced creativity.
7. Aggressive edge: In the end as talked about above, the principle objective is a aggressive edge, a successful probability, a head- begin within the race. Modernized apps could assist companies stay forward of the competitors by permitting them to supply new options, ship quicker updates, and adapt to market adjustments extra effectively. By providing distinctive, quick-to-market functions, your organization could higher adapt to new market prospects, enhance effectivity, and interact customers. In line with IDC analysis, corporations that interact in trendy software growth processes get 51% quicker time-to-market and 41% extra frequent distributions of software program than those that don’t.
Figuring out When Your Firm Wants Utility Modernization
Figuring out when your organization’s techniques require modernization is vital for staying aggressive, rising productiveness, and making certain long-term success. Listed below are some important indicators that it’s time to discover software modernization:
- Efficiency Issues: Recurrent issues together with your functions, together with sluggish response occasions, system failures, or blackouts, could also be an indication that they don’t seem to be in a position to deal with the present workload.
- Safety Vulnerabilities: Safety dangers usually tend to have an effect on legacy techniques. Your organization is susceptible to knowledge breaches and cyberattacks in case your apps should not have the most recent safety features and upgrades.
- Lack of flexibility and scalability: Your group’s progress could also be hindered in case your current functions will not be versatile and scalable sufficient to satisfy altering enterprise necessities or rising workloads. With the intention to adapt to altering necessities, trendy functions are made to be extra scalable and adaptable.
- Issue in Integration: Information move and cooperation could also be hampered in case your functions are tough to combine with different techniques in your organization or with outdoors companions.
- Insufficient consumer expertise: A poor consumer expertise can lead to buyer and employees dissatisfaction. Your functions may benefit from modernization in the event that they lack options that enhance usability or have an outdated consumer interface.
The Greatest Methods For Utility Modernization
Utility modernization is a posh course of that requires extreme consideration to particulars. It’s typically useful to work with a cross-functional crew and contain key stakeholders all through the modernization journey. Listed below are a number of of one of the best methods to undertake whereas modernizing your system software program software:
- Automation Is Key: Modernization groups are steadily caught with handbook strategies that don’t scale throughout a whole software property. Thus, including clever automation, AI, and knowledge science to modernization and creating a repeatable pipeline for refactoring are vital.
- Outline enterprise Targets: An software modernization analysis begins by defining which enterprise objectives the corporate desires to realize via modernization. Widespread company motivations driving app modernization embody price financial savings, efficiency enhancement, enhanced safety, and simplified administration.
- Deep Utility Commentary: To modernize an current monolith, deep commentary is required along with fundamental static code evaluation. This consists of deeper domain-driven habits evaluation and repeatedly monitoring dependency interactions.
- Consumer Coaching and Change Administration: Make investments in these areas to assist finish customers transfer easily. Emphasize the benefits of modernization initiatives and supply help all through the adoption course of.
- Frequent Updating and Upkeep: The method of modernization by no means ends. To make sure that packages keep up-to-date with altering enterprise necessities and expertise adjustments, schedule frequent upgrades and upkeep.
How Can Fingent Assist?
Leveraging app modernization to enhance effectivity is a difficult activity, however fear not as a result of a reliable growth answer like Fingent can accomplish it with ease. At Fingent, our crew of execs can implement cutting-edge expertise resembling cloud-native options, synthetic intelligence, and machine studying software program in your group. With glad clients worldwide, we offer tailor-made service and assist to suit your firm’s wants, with the pliability to scale as wanted.
Contact us to study extra about how we will help!


